Have you eaten too much over the holidays? You should try fidgeting, or moving your hands or feet for a while. Those around you might not like it, but scratching and twitching is an important way of burning up calories.
    American researchers have found that some people’s squirming and wiggling equals several miles of jogging each day.
    The scientists, based at the National Institute of Health’s laboratory in Phoenix, Arizona, are studying why some people get fat and others stay slim.
    In one study, 177 people each spent 24 hours in the institute’s respiratory chamber—a room where the amount of energy people expend is measured by their oxygen and carbon dioxide levels. By the end of the day, some people had burned up 800 calories in toe-tapping, finger-drumming and other nervous habits. However, others had expended only 100 calories.
    The researchers found that slim women fidget more than fat women, but there was net significant difference in men. Heavy people expend more energy when they fidget than do thin people.
